Ludovic Lalanne

Ludovic Lalanne (23 April 1815, Paris – 16 May 1898, Paris) was a French historian and librarian.

The engineer and politician Léon Lalanne (1811–1892) was his brother.

Lalanne was a student at the lycée Louis-le-Grand and later at the École des Chartes, where he was graduated archivist paleographer in 1841.

He was a resident member of the Comité des travaux historiques et scientifiques, archivist of the Société de l'École des chartes and president of the Société de l'histoire de France.
